taken from Destructoid:

 

"Electronic Arts had a Wii port of Dead Space 2 game planned, along with a follow up to the utterly awful The Simpsons Game. Both titles have been scrapped in favor of other projects. I'm no analyst, but I'm willing to bet that nothing of value was lost.

The news comes via the LinkedIn profiles of EA designer Gerry Sakkas and freelance developer Matt Spriggens, who list the cancelled games among their work.
